jere is not as item-dependent as vindi actually. You can get away with just an arcane ring late game, where as vindi needs force staff + guinsoo/a lot of hp or he dies instantly/does no damage. Not saying he shouldn't help with wards and stuff, but jere isn't really item dependent overall.

The difference between strong support and weak support is their ability to farm in slow times of the game. A jere with just a few items (even + stats and stuff) can still cast all his spells to help his team. A vindi in a team fight is just an ultimate and then all he is is dps (his aura helps, but you can easily get focused down, much faster than a jere). If he has no items, he just is an ult then your team fights 4v5, whereas jere helps your team the entire fight. Also, you can farm the jungle very well with jere, something a vindicator cannot do.
